The disappearance of prominent Kenyan social media personality Maverick Aoko has sparked widespread concern and speculation among her followers and fellow netizens.

Aoko, known for her outspoken and often controversial opinions, has not been active on her social media accounts for over 25 hours, leading to a flurry of anxious tweets and posts under the hashtag #FreeAoko.

The alarm was first raised when several users noticed that Aoko's Twitter account, which she frequently used to share her thoughts and engage with followers, had been deactivated.

This sudden silence from someone as vocal as Aoko sent shockwaves through the online community, with many fearing the worst.

"Where is Aoko?" has become the rallying cry on Twitter, with countless users expressing their concern and demanding answers.

Kelvin Kusienya, one of the many who tweeted, highlighted the unsettling fact that all of Aoko's posts had been deleted, yet her account remained accessible.

Others, like Juma Mukosi, speculated that Aoko's disappearance might be linked to a broader scheme to silence her after her manager had reportedly been targeted first.

The situation escalated as public figures and ordinary citizens alike joined the growing chorus of voices seeking Aoko's whereabouts.

Senator Okiya Omtatah, a renowned activist, tweeted a chilling message suggesting that Aoko had been subjected to severe mistreatment, including physical violence and miscarriage.

"Ambushed, roughed up naked. Beaten to miscarriage. Bungled onto a cold remand floor for days. Now, her X account gone! Whereabouts unknown?" Omtatah wrote, further fueling the concerns of her safety.

The lack of official communication or confirmation regarding Aoko's situation has only intensified the anxiety.

Prominent users like Duke of Kabondoshire and Kapelo have echoed the sentiment, urging the public to continue demanding answers until Aoko is found safe.

Even Babu Owino, a political figure, has been called upon to use his influence to uncover Aoko's location, with some suggesting that this could be his first major test as a self-proclaimed "Luo Kingpin."

As the hashtag #FreeAoko continues to trend, the situation remains tense, with her followers growing increasingly impatient.

The online community has made it clear that they will not rest until Aoko is located and her safety is assured.
